In regards to how to manage a major construction project efficiently, one of the most important skills is communication. Reliable and regular communication is at the heart of every single successful construction project. These communication skills will certainly be used every single day at the site, whether its collaborating with subcontractors and vendors or liaising with the clients. Communicating complex technical information in a clear and succinct manner will certainly be very vital and will really help ensure that the various teams involved in the project are all on the exact same page. It is vital to keep in mind that this communication goes two ways; an excellent construction manager will also foster open lines of communication and actively listen to feedback from any of the various other construction employees that are working on the project.

When it comes to leading a big construction project, it is unsurprising that having strong leadership abilities is absolutely fundamental. Being able to inspire, motivate and guide multiple teams towards a common target is ultimately what makes a good project manager in construction. Additionally, an excellent construction manager should be capable of steering diverse groups through the complexities, pressures and unanticipated hurdles associated with such large-scale projects. It is the leader's responsibility to entrust their team and delegate tasks based off their specific area of expertise. At the same time, a strong leader should also be able to take control of situations, give directions and make fast decisions under stress. Besides, even the most ordered and well-managed construction sites will run into some unexpected hurdles eventually throughout the building process. A leader will remain calm, analyze the situation and develop a solution.

For such expensive and taxing ventures, only the most experienced and well-informed professionals will be hired as the project managers. These individuals will be seasoned experts on exactly how to manage construction projects effectively and successfully. As a bare minimum, these individuals will possess a strong understanding of all the technical aspects of construction, whether its interpreting blueprints, evaluating cost spread sheets, understanding building codes or reviewing construction techniques. Nevertheless, these construction managers will also appreciate the numerous soft skills associated with running a construction project to that size. For instance, they will know that being adaptable and flexible is extremely essential, specifically when circumstances could have changed and there's an element of adversity, such as supply chain interruptions or inclement . weather. Essentially, effective construction managers are proficient at changing plans and shifting resources as needed to keep the project on course.
